Event Write-Up
By
Rolling green hills and brilliant blue skies greeted the 150 orienteers who ventured to Benicia for the inaugural event on BAOC's newest map. With generally open terrain, pleasant temperature, fairly soft ground, and modest climbs, conditions were favorable for very fast times, and the results showed that to be the case.
Greg Mandler won the White course. Teresa Jansson was in second place and the first female finisher. Greg, incidentally, proceeded to run Yellow, Orange, and Brown, and turned in good times on all of them. Leander Coolen was victorious on Yellow. For the most part, groups ran Yellow, with about 60 people altogether running this course. The team of Benjamin, Zi, and Matias had a solid win on Orange, with a time that compared well with BAOC advanced runners who did Orange as a second course.
On the Brown course, Ray Rosenbaum won over Tommy Ingulfsen in the closest results of the day, with a mere 70-second margin. Leslie Minarik was the first female on Brown.
With Green being the hardest course offered, it featured a strong and crowded field (36 entries). Erin Schirm ran a solid race to win by about two minutes over François Léonard. Francois had the fastest time on most legs, but lost enough time on the innocuous-looking control #10 to give up the lead. Bill Cusworth was third, and Tori Borish was the first female in fourth.
The herd of goats that has been grazing in the park for the past several weeks obviously decided they needed a better view of the competition, so in the very early hours of Sunday they marched about 700 meters down the hill and set themselves up by Green #11 and Brown #10, along with their (mildly electrified) fences. I had seen some new temporary fences in the area Saturday afternoon while setting controls, but had been informed on Friday that the goats would still be well away from the action. My apologies to anybody who encountered difficulty due to the surprise obstacles in this area.
Fitting for an event on Oscar Sunday, I have many people to thank. First is Emily Radtke, who two years ago, as a middle-school student, decided to make an orienteering map of her favorite local park for her Girl Scout Silver Award project. I got to be her project adviser, and I was impressed with the effort and skill she put into this. Right behind Emily is her mother, Betsy Radtke, who apparently knows everybody in Benicia and made the process of putting on this event easier at every step. Now for our other wonderful volunteers:
